Imo Governor-Elect Ihedioha Floors Opponent In Court

A suit filed by Senator Samuel Anyanwu, challenging the emergence of Imo State Governor-elect, Emeka Ihedioha as the governorship candidate of the Peoples Democratic Party, PDP has been thrown aside by a Federal Court sitting in Owerri, Imo State capital.





Senator Anyanwu, representing Imo East in the Senate, had approached the court seeking to nullify the victory of Ihedioha.

Anyanwu told the court that he should be declared as the authentic winner of the PDP gubernatorial primary election in the State. He also accused the former Deputy Speaker of the House of Representatives of engaging in over voting, thuggery, which he alleged, swayed the polls in his favour.

Delivering his ruling on the matter Thursday, Justice Tijani Ringim, pointed out that the plaintiff did not convince the court on the prayers he sought.

The judge said the court could not establish the fact in his claims and therefore dismissed the suit for lack of proof.
